In today’s fast-paced world, technology plays a crucial role in our lives, be it personal or professional. And in the world of business, organizations lean heavily on technology to remain competitive and make strides. At the center of it all is the Chief Technology Officer (CTO). A CTO is responsible for an organization’s technical vision and oversees all aspects of the company’s technology development, including software engineering, IT infrastructure, and product development.
Taking on the Role of a CTO
As businesses continue to look for innovative ways to differentiate themselves and stay ahead of the curve, the role of a CTO becomes more important than ever. A CTO not only aligns technology strategy with business strategy but also helps companies harness technology to be more efficient and productive.
However, being a CTO is not just about technical knowledge. It requires a unique combination of skills that includes excellent leadership abilities, strategic thinking, and financial acumen. A CTO must be able to supervise and mentor teams of developers and IT specialists, manage budgets, and cut through the complexities of the ever-changing technology landscape.
The Responsibilities of a CTO
The responsibilities of a CTO are vast and complex. They are expected to:
- Lead technical vision and strategy development to support business needs
- Coordinate with other C-level executives to align technology strategy with business strategy
- Identify technology trends and new developments that can improve the company’s efficiencies and profitability
- Oversee the development and maintenance of the company’s software, applications, and systems
- Ensure compliance with the latest regulatory standards and industry best practices
- Manage budgets, costs, and resources related to technology
- Recruit and manage talented IT staff, providing them with technical guidance, mentorship, and development opportunities.
